     n 1: a condition of urgency making it necessary to hurry; "in a
          hurry to lock the door" [syn: haste]
     2: overly eager speed (and possible carelessness); "he soon
        regretted his haste" [syn: haste, hastiness, hurriedness]
     3: the act of moving hurriedly and in a careless manner; "in
        his haste to leave he forgot his book" [syn: haste, rush,
         rushing]
     v 1: move very fast; "The runner zipped past us at breakneck
          speed" [syn: travel rapidly, speed, zip]
     2: act or move at high speed; "We have to rush!" [syn: rush,
        hasten, look sharp]
     3: urge to an unnatural speed; "Don't rush me, please!" [syn: rush]
        [ant: delay]
